Overview
- WhatsApp now lets users register and use the iPad app independently, though account creation still requires a phone number and an SMS confirmation code.
- The company has fully refreshed the Android Auto and Apple CarPlay interfaces so drivers can listen to messages, reply by voice, start and take WhatsApp calls, view call history and reach favorite contacts via the vehicle display.
- WhatsApp Web and Desktop support opening PDFs directly in chat and basic edits such as highlighting and annotations through an Adobe Acrobat integration without downloading files.
- The new PDF editing tools are currently available on Web and Desktop only and Meta says the broader rollout will be gradual, so smartphone and tablet access will come later for some users.
- Users should update their apps to get features as they reach accounts and expect phased availability by platform and region; the changes signal Meta’s push to make quick document review and hands‑free messaging more practical across everyday devices.
